The subject of a contract is typically the exchange of some type of goods or services. A contract must include all relevant information about the exchange. Essentially, anyone can draft a contract on their own; an attorney is not required to form a valid contract.
Elements of a Contract Offer - One of the parties made a promise to do or refrain from doing some specified action in the future. Consideration - Something of value was promised in exchange for the specified action or nonaction. Acceptance - The offer was accepted unambiguously.
Contract type is a term used to signify differences in contract structure or form, including compensation arrangements and amount of risk (either to the government or to the contractor). Federal government contracts are commonly divided into two main types, fixed-price and cost-reimbursement.
How to write a letter of agreement Title the document. Add the title at the top of the document. List your personal information. Include the date. Add the recipients personal information. Address the recipient. Write an introduction paragraph. Write your body. Conclude the letter.
Standard form contracts are intended to make common agreements between suppliers and consumers more efficient and less costly. You can find some of these forms (for example, lease agreements, construction contracts, and divorce papers) either at your local office supply store or online.

The three most common contract types include: Fixed-price contracts. Cost-plus contracts. Time and materials contracts.
Why You Need a Business Contract Lawyer. If youre asking whether you need a lawyer to draft a contract, legally, the answer is no. Anyone can draft a contract on their own and as long as the elements above are included and both parties are legally competent and consent to the agreement, it is generally lawful.
Common agreements include Employment Agreements, Employee Non-Compete Agreements, Independent Contractor Agreements, Consulting Agreements, Distributor Agreements, Sales Representative Agreements, Confidentiality Agreements, Reciprocal Nondisclosure Agreements, and Employment Separation Agreements.
A contract is an agreement between parties, creating mutual obligations that are enforceable by law.
How To Draft a Contract Step by Step Information Gathering. List Your Services or Products. Determine Term Length. Lay Out the Consequences. Determine Dispute Resolution Terms. Create Signature and Date Lines.
